A global provider of specialist wireless communication systems is seeking an experienced and confident Marketing Manager to lead its dynamic marketing function and support sales teams across the UK, USA, and Europe. This is a hands-on role where you’ll be responsible for planning and delivering end-to-end B2B marketing campaigns, managing events, and driving content strategy. You will work closely with the sales teams to boost brand visibility and generate leads across key markets.
Responsibilities
- Develop and implement integrated B2B marketing strategies across both digital and offline channels
- Lead and execute marketing initiatives that align with broader commercial goals
- Plan and manage events in the UK and internationally, ensuring strong brand presence
- Create and refine content for various platforms, including LinkedIn, the company website, email campaigns, and printed collateral
- Work closely with the sales team to support business objectives and drive high-quality lead generation
- Write compelling, targeted copy for a range of digital and print materials
- Coordinate photoshoots and video productions in collaboration with external partners and talent
- Maintain and update the company website using Webflow
Qualifications
- Proven B2B Marketing experience
- Ability to multi-task
- Strong verbal, written, and organizational skills
